Piazza dei Cavalieri (Cavalieri / Knights Square)

Designed during the mid-16th century by Giorgio Vasari, the Piazza dei Cavalieri opens unexpectedly from Pisa's narrow backstreets and the central piazza in Pisa.
The curving Palazzo dei Cavalieri features elaborate busts of the Medici and is situated next to Pisa's the church of Santo Stefano dei Cavalieri. Across the square is the imposing Palazzo dell'Orologio, and to the east is the Borgo Stretto, one of Pisa's most impressive streets with a wide selection of speciality shops and cafés.
Pisa's Piazza dei Cavalieri was once the seat of the Ordine dei Cavalieri di Santo Stefano, (Order of the Knights of St. Stephen), which was an important religious and military institution in Pisa, created in order to defend the coastline from possible attacked by the Turks.
